Overview of 2SC2389S Transistor
The 2SC2389S is a high-performance NPN bipolar junction transistor (BJT) that is widely used in various electronic circuits. Known for its efficient switching characteristics, this transistor is ideal for applications requiring reliable amplification or signal processing. Its compact design and robust parameters make it a favorite among engineers and hobbyists alike.
Features and Benefits
- High Gain: Offers a substantial current gain, which is crucial for effective amplification.
- Compact Design: Its small size allows for easy integration into various circuit designs.
- Low Saturation Voltage: Enhances efficiency by reducing power loss.
- Durable Construction: Built to withstand high stress and temperatures, ensuring longevity in various applications.
Applications
- Audio Amplifiers
- Signal Processing Circuits
- Switching Power Supplies
- Battery Operated Devices
- RF Signal Amplification
The 2SC2389S is a versatile component that suits a plethora of projects ranging from hobbyist kits to professional electronic devices. Its excellent thermal stability and high-frequency capabilities make it particularly well-suited for RF and audio applications.
